Tachyon solution in a~cubic Neveu--Schwarz string field theory
Teoretičeskaâ i matematičeskaâ fizika, Tome 158 (2009) no. 3, pp. 378-390

Voir la notice de l'article provenant de la source Math-Net.Ru

We find a class of analytic solutions in a modified cubic theory of fermionic strings that includes the $GSO(-)$ sector. This class contains a solution that involves a tachyon field from the $GSO(-)$ sector and reproduces the correct value of the non-BPS D-brane tension.
Keywords: string field theory, superstring, tachyon condensation.
